A Career Advancement Programme in Retail Crisis Management equips participants with the skills and knowledge to effectively navigate unexpected events and maintain business continuity. The program focuses on developing proactive strategies and reactive responses for various crisis scenarios.
Learning outcomes include mastering crisis communication techniques, developing robust contingency plans, and implementing effective risk assessment methodologies. Participants will gain practical experience through simulations and case studies, enhancing their problem-solving abilities within the retail sector. Effective leadership and team management in times of stress are also key components.
The duration of the programme typically spans several weeks or months, depending on the chosen intensity and learning format (e.g., online, in-person, blended learning). The curriculum is designed to be modular, allowing for flexibility in scheduling and accommodating diverse professional commitments.
